917618-27-0

1-Propene-1,2,3-tricarboxylic acid, 1,2,3-tris(5-methylhexyl) ester, (1E)-

Cas Number: 917618-27-0  Molecular Structure
Product Code
778080
Product Name
1-Propene-1,2,3-tricarboxylic acid, 1,2,3-tris(5-methylhexyl) ester, (1E)-
Cas Number
917618-27-0
Molecular Formula
C27H48O6